Part Number
74HCT08DB,112-NEX
Category
Logic - Gates and Inverters
Manufacturer
Nexperia USA Inc.
Description
IC GATE AND 4CH 2-INP 14SSOP
Package
Tube
Series
74HCT
Features
-
Voltage - Supply
4.5V ~ 5.5V
Operating Temperature
-40°C ~ 125°C
Mounting Type
Surface Mount
Package / Case
14-SSOP (0.209\", 5.30mm Width)
Supplier Device Package
14-SSOP
Number of Circuits
4
Number of Inputs
2
Current - Output High, Low
4mA, 5.2mA
Current - Quiescent (Max)
2 µA
Logic Type
AND Gate
Max Propagation Delay @ V, Max CL
24ns @ 4.5V, 50pF
Logic Level - Low
0.8V
Logic Level - High
1.6V
